Output d989b9f600ca63a138ecb6d749b3ae36d16aaf1b7ff2fa19a8eb1c433d0b7e42:2

value
52435890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d4af9ed3ee875d8e3539421c00533f63299078e OP_EQUAL
address
MLnFKvPTJocKeMqGHsNnmRiduoQ9N4bsG9
transaction
d989b9f600ca63a138ecb6d749b3ae36d16aaf1b7ff2fa19a8eb1c433d0b7e42
spent
true